cppcheck analysis of audacious-plugins_2.4.4-1.dsc
- ./src/aac/libmp4.c:974 [error] - Memory leak: mp4cb
- ./src/adplug/adplug-xmms.cc:1082 [error] - Mismatching allocation and deallocation: cfgval
- ./src/adplug/core/cff.cxx:83 [error] - Mismatching allocation and deallocation: module
- ./src/adplug/core/cff.cxx:92 [error] - Mismatching allocation and deallocation: module
- ./src/adplug/core/cff.cxx:82 [error] - Mismatching allocation and deallocation: packed_module
- ./src/adplug/core/cff.cxx:88 [error] - Mismatching allocation and deallocation: packed_module
- ./src/adplug/core/dtm.cxx:151 [error] - Mismatching allocation and deallocation: pattern
- ./src/adplug/core/fmopl.c:601 [error] - Buffer access out-of-bounds: OPL.AR_TABLE
- ./src/adplug/core/fmopl.c:602 [error] - Buffer access out-of-bounds: OPL.DR_TABLE
- ./src/adplug/core/ksm.cxx:59 [error] - Memory leak: fn
- ./src/alsa/alsa.c:376 [error] - Uninitialized variable: rate
- ./src/amidi-plug/i_midi.c:367 [error] - Memory leak: event
- ./src/bluetooth/agent.c:249 [error] - Memory leak: input
- ./src/bluetooth/agent.c:277 [error] - Memory leak: input
- ./src/compressor/compressor.c:201 [error] - Common realloc mistake: "buffer" nulled but not freed upon failure
- ./src/compressor/compressor.c:202 [error] - Common realloc mistake: "peaks" nulled but not freed upon failure
- ./src/daap/daap.c:134 [error] - Memory leak: data
- ./src/daap/daap.c:316 [error] - Memory leak: handle
- ./src/daap/xmms2-daap/daap_mdns_avahi.c:141 [error] - Memory leak: b
- ./src/daap/xmms2-daap/daap_mdns_avahi.c:249 [error] - Memory leak: browse_userdata
- ./src/daap/xmms2-daap/daap_xform.c:219 [error] - Memory leak: login_data
- ./src/daap/xmms2-daap/daap_xform.c:296 [error] - Memory leak: data
- ./src/daap/xmms2-daap/daap_xform.c:313 [error] - Memory leak: login_data
- ./src/evdev-plug/ed_ui.c:1117 [error] - Mismatching allocation and deallocation: popul_binding
- ./src/evdev-plug/ed_ui.c:1270 [error] - Mismatching allocation and deallocation: array_actioncode
- ./src/modplug/load_ams.cxx:629 [error] - Mismatching allocation and deallocation: amstmp
- ./src/modplug/load_dsm.cxx:112 [error] - Buffer access out-of-bounds: psong.orders
- ./src/modplug/load_mdl.cxx:274 [error] - Mismatching allocation and deallocation: CSoundFile::m_lpszSongComments
- ./src/modplug/modplugbmp.cxx:109 [error] - Buffer access out-of-bounds: magic
- ./src/modplug/modplugbmp.cxx:113 [error] - Buffer access out-of-bounds: magic
- ./src/modplug/modplugbmp.cxx:115 [error] - Buffer access out-of-bounds: magic
- ./src/modplug/modplugbmp.cxx:117 [error] - Buffer access out-of-bounds: magic
- ./src/modplug/modplugbmp.cxx:119 [error] - Buffer access out-of-bounds: magic
- ./src/modplug/modplugbmp.cxx:126 [error] - Buffer access out-of-bounds: magic
- ./src/modplug/modplugbmp.cxx:147 [error] - Buffer access out-of-bounds: magic
- ./src/modplug/modplugbmp.cxx:149 [error] - Buffer access out-of-bounds: magic
- ./src/modplug/modplugbmp.cxx:151 [error] - Buffer access out-of-bounds: magic
- ./src/modplug/modplugbmp.cxx:153 [error] - Buffer access out-of-bounds: magic
- ./src/modplug/modplugbmp.cxx:155 [error] - Buffer access out-of-bounds: magic
- ./src/modplug/modplugbmp.cxx:157 [error] - Buffer access out-of-bounds: magic
- ./src/modplug/modplugbmp.cxx:159 [error] - Buffer access out-of-bounds: magic
- ./src/modplug/modplugbmp.cxx:161 [error] - Buffer access out-of-bounds: magic
- ./src/modplug/modplugbmp.cxx:163 [error] - Buffer access out-of-bounds: magic
- ./src/modplug/modplugbmp.cxx:165 [error] - Buffer access out-of-bounds: magic
- ./src/modplug/modplugbmp.cxx:167 [error] - Buffer access out-of-bounds: magic
- ./src/modplug/modplugbmp.cxx:169 [error] - Buffer access out-of-bounds: magic
- ./src/modplug/sndfile.cxx:749 [style] - Redundant assignment of "n" in switch
- ./src/mtp_up/mtp.c:187 [error] - Memory leak: from_path
- ./src/paranormal/libcalc/parser.c:1775 [error] - Memory leak: saved_locale
- ./src/scrobbler/scrobbler.c:322 [error] - Common realloc mistake: "sc_srv_res" nulled but not freed upon failure
- ./src/scrobbler/scrobbler.c:981 [error] - Mismatching allocation and deallocation: artist
- ./src/scrobbler/scrobbler.c:982 [error] - Mismatching allocation and deallocation: title
- ./src/scrobbler/scrobbler.c:983 [error] - Mismatching allocation and deallocation: album
- ./src/sid/xs_config.c:569 [error] - Mismatching allocation and deallocation: sectName
- ./src/spectrum/spectrum.c:215 [error] - Array 'bar_heights[256]' index -1 out of bounds
- ./src/spectrum/spectrum.c:216 [error] - Array 'bar_heights[256]' index 256 out of bounds
- ./src/streambrowser/xiph.c:238 [error] - Common realloc mistake: "xiph_entries" nulled but not freed upon failure
- ./src/sun/configure.c:425 [error] - Undefined behaviour: s is used wrong in call to sprintf or snprintf. Quote: If copying takes place between objects that overlap as a result of a call to sprintf() or snprintf(), the results are undefined.
- ./src/sun/configure.c:509 [error] - Undefined behaviour: s is used wrong in call to sprintf or snprintf. Quote: If copying takes place between objects that overlap as a result of a call to sprintf() or snprintf(), the results are undefined.
- ./src/sun/configure.c:512 [error] - Undefined behaviour: s is used wrong in call to sprintf or snprintf. Quote: If copying takes place between objects that overlap as a result of a call to sprintf() or snprintf(), the results are undefined.
- ./src/vtx/vtxfile.c:183 [error] - Common realloc mistake: "packed_data" nulled but not freed upon failure
Note: if you think the results reveal a security bug,
please don't hesitate to contact the
security team
This report was generated on Sat, 16 Apr 2011 06:58:02 +0000, based on results by cppcheck 1.46